>> Not with the hdsp mixer (I mean the matrix mixer in the hdsp based RME
>> sound cards, not the software); it's state is not saved by ALSA, and I
>> even doubt that it can be read at all.
> 
> If it can't be read you can't use 'alsactl store'.
> But AFAIK 'alsactl restore' uses the equivalent of
> amixer's sset and/or cset commands, so provided you
> can somehow create the required file, 'alsactl restore'
> should work ? 

alsactl store/restore works for most parameters (e.g., clock rate, clock
source, SPDIF-flags etc), but not for the matrix mixer of the hdsp
cards. The reason is probably that the mixer element "numid=5" is a
complex mixer with three arguments, where the first two define the
address of the mixer element in the hardware mixer, and the third one
its value. Thus, all hardware mixer elements are accessed through a
single ALSA mixer element (the hdsp cards have up to 2*26^2=1352 mixer
elements). The read command of numid=5 always returns the triplet 0,0,0.
